Windows Kafka可视化工具kafkatool_64bit.exe发布

需积分: 2 2 下载量 6 浏览量 更新于2024-11-16 收藏 58.71MB RAR 举报
资源摘要信息:"kafkatool_64bit.exe 是一款专为 Windows 操作系统设计的 Kafka 可视化工具。Kafka(Apache Kafka)是一个开源流处理平台,主要用于构建实时数据管道和流应用程序。它具备高吞吐量、可持久化、可水平扩展等特点,并且支持发布和订阅消息模式、以及数据的分区和复制。Kafkatool_64bit.exe 作为一款为 Kafka 设计的可视化工具,它提供了图形用户界面(GUI),使得用户能够更加直观地管理、监控 Kafka 集群,以及执行各种操作,比如创建和管理主题、生产者、消费者和消费者群组等。该工具通过简化操作流程,有效地提高了 Kafka 的使用便捷性。" 知识点: 1. Kafka 概述: - Kafka 是一个分布式的流处理平台,最初由 LinkedIn 公司开发,并且作为开源项目贡献给了 Apache 软件基金会。 - 它能够处理高并发的实时数据流,并且常被用于构建日志收集系统、消息队列系统以及事件源等。 - Kafka 的主要特点包括高吞吐量、低延迟、可扩展性和持久性。 2. Kafka 核心概念: - 主题(Topic): Kafka 中数据的分类名,生产者发布消息和消费者订阅消息都是围绕主题进行。 - 分区(Partition): 主题可以被分成多个分区,分区可以分布在不同的服务器上,实现负载均衡和数据的高可用性。 - 副本(Replica): Kafka 会将数据复制到多个服务器上,以防止数据丢失。 - 生产者(Producer): 向 Kafka 主题发布消息的客户端。 - 消费者(Consumer): 从 Kafka 主题订阅并消费消息的客户端。 - 消费者群组(Consumer Group): 消费者可以组织成一个群组共同消费一个主题的消息,通过分区的分配机制来实现负载均衡。 3. Kafka 工具的作用: - Kafka 工具可以协助用户进行集群管理、监控和消息生产与消费。 - 它能够帮助用户通过图形界面直观地查看集群状态、进行主题配置和调整、以及监控消息流。 4. kafkatool_64bit.exe 的功能特点: - 该工具是针对 Windows 用户设计的,易于安装和使用。 - 提供了可视化界面,使得用户能够轻松地进行 Kafka 集群的操作,减少了命令行操作的复杂性。 - 支持创建、编辑和删除 Kafka 主题,以及查看主题详细信息。 - 可以监控生产者和消费者的行为,包括消息的发送和接收情况。 - 通过直观的图形界面,用户可以更好地理解和管理 Kafka 的工作流程。 5. 使用 kafkatool_64bit.exe 的好处: - 提高效率:图形界面比传统的命令行操作更加直观,减少了用户学习和操作的成本。 - 减少错误:通过图形界面执行操作比手动编写命令出错的概率更低。 - 方便监控:实时图形化展示 Kafka 集群的运行状态,帮助用户快速定位问题。 - 功能强大:该工具不仅覆盖了基础管理功能,通常还会包含高级特性,如消息的生产和消费监控、集群状态告警等。 6. 适用场景: - Kafka 的初学者可以通过该工具快速上手 Kafka 的使用。 - 对于需要进行日常维护和故障排查的运维人员,该工具能够提供必要的视图和监控信息。 - 系统管理员可以利用该工具管理和优化 Kafka 集群,提高集群的稳定性和性能。 7. 注意事项: - 在使用 kafkatool_64bit.exe 之前,确保已经正确安装并配置了 Kafka 环境。 - 对于复杂的 Kafka 集群环境,建议先熟悉 Kafka 的基本概念和操作,再使用可视化工具。 - 依赖于第三方工具进行集群管理时,需要关注工具的更新和维护,确保与 Kafka 版本兼容。 - 在生产环境中使用可视化工具时,应确保工具本身的安全性和稳定性,避免引入不必要的风险。